Nabe is a great winter food that you can adjust to suit what's available in your area. Do you know nabe? (If not, the last link has some information about nabe if you look at the contents list) I loooove nabe, it's warm, cosy and a great meal to just relax and chat over. Then later zosui!(rice and egg added to left over soup stock to make a risotto) It is easy to eat too much though....
